Product management is a critical role in any organization that develops and sells products. It involves overseeing the entire product lifecycle, from ideation to launch and beyond. One of the most important aspects of product management is building and managing a product team. This team is responsible for designing, developing, and delivering the product to the market. In this post, we’ll discuss the essential elements of building and managing a successful product team.

First, it’s important to understand the different roles that make up a product team. A typical product team consists of product managers, designers, developers, and marketers. Product managers are responsible for defining the product strategy and ensuring that the team is working towards the same goals. Designers create the user interface and user experience of the product. Developers build the product and ensure that it functions as intended. Marketers promote the product and ensure that it reaches the intended audience.

Once you have a team in place, it’s essential to establish clear roles and responsibilities. Each team member should understand their role and how it contributes to the success of the product. Regular communication and collaboration are also critical. The team should have regular meetings to discuss progress, identify roadblocks, and make decisions as a group.

Another important aspect of building and managing a product team is creating a culture of continuous improvement. This involves encouraging team members to share feedback and ideas for improving the product and the team’s processes. It also involves providing opportunities for training and development to help team members grow in their roles.

In conclusion, building and managing a successful product team requires a combination of clear roles and responsibilities, regular communication and collaboration, and a culture of continuous improvement. As a product manager, it’s essential to prioritize these elements to ensure that your team is working towards the same goals and delivering high-quality products to the market. By following these best practices, you can build and manage a product team that drives success for your organization.
